ADVICE TO A LOVER, by                    
First Line: Oh! If you love her
Last Line: Oh! If you love her.
Subject(s): Love


OH! if you love her,
Show her the best of you;
So will you move her
To bear with the rest of you.
Coldness and jealousy
Cannot but seem to her
Signs that a tempest lurks
Where was sunbeam to her.
Patience and tenderness
Still will awake in her
Hopes of new sunshine,
Tho' the storm break for her;
Love, she will know, for her,
Like the blue firmament,
Under the tempest lies
Gentle and permanent.
Nor will she ever
Gentleness find the less,
When the storm overblown
Leaveth clear kindliness.
Deal with her tenderly,
Skylike above her,
Smile on her waywardness,
Oh! if you love her.
